El Ranchito Restaurant is a restaurant located in Harrisburg, IL. It is one of 41 restaurants listed in Harrisburg. Its 4.4-star rating is above the Harrisburg city average of 4.2 stars. It ranks #10 of 41 restaurants in Harrisburg. There are 10 photos associated with this location.
